Crives wrote:
bwgood77 wrote:
Crives wrote:Play defense and abuse Memphis poor perimeter defense to create open shots. Need another convincing win.


Does Memphis have poor perimeter defense?


Book/Rubio should be able to break apart Ja + Dillon.


Well, too many people think about these one on one matchups, and Rubio's not a whole lot to stop on offense for Ja, and Dillon isn't bad. But they have a lot of solid team defenders that can switch, from Jaren Jackson Jr to Kyle Anderson to Brandon Clarke to Jae Crowder. Grayson Allen is a pretty scrappy defender too.

And Tyus Jones, their backup PG, was 2nd among PGs in DRPM a couple years ago...he dropped a bit last year but he's still solid.

I don't think you should expect these guys to be that weak defensively.

Their offense might stink, but their defense might be pretty good despite the points they've given up. They have some talent. We will need to move the ball and hit our shots.
